I want to solve the problem of learning a second language in contexts that actually make it difficult (economical, cultural, etc).
Teach a second language is very difficult for teachers since details as pronunciation and spelling needs lots of repetition and while the individual feedback is key, there is not much time to make it with the students.
Even more, students frequently avoid interactions with the teacher since they have low frustration tolerance to the multiple corrections.
The idea of this solution is to solve both, the lack of time to correct and the disgust for correction by creating an environment for learners, where they interchange their roles of learners and teachers, by teaching their mother tongue as they learn the other student's mother tongue.
Feeling that they are the experts in their part will help them bear the dislike for corrections, since they are good in their part.
An interactive application where two kids with different mother tongues learn one word, phrase, grammatical structure in the other's language as they teach the same content in their own language.
The application makes kids in different places see each other in real time and show them words (or more complex language structures) that each one teaches to the other.
Each kid corrects the pronunciation or spelling of the other kid and then receives equivalent feedback for the same word but in the other language.
On the first stages, the system would just need a system of points to let the kids consider the word is correctly learned by the other and advance to the next and make some reviews every number of words depending on the age.
As it advances, it would need extra technical support to work in the spelling and grammar of the languages.
Most people in the world speaks just one language and be able to learn a second language is very difficult due to economic situations.
The level of feedback necessary to really learn a second language is extremely expensive, so few students can have that privilege.
This solution will give this feedback without increasing the load of the teacher and even more, will develop in kids several social and emotional skills that will empower them for their future, since they will be teachers and learners.
I am a science teacher with 13 years of work trying to make learning meaningful to students. I teach in my student's second language, so I have noticed their difficulties in get the fluidity and confidence in real time.
I work with teens from 13 to 18 years and I try to support low income kids that are close to my life and noticed their desire to advance but also their struggle in get feedback.
I personally learned English mostly by the method I am proposing, since I interacted with native English teachers and we agreed in correct one another in our respective mother tongues. Since both were learners and teachers, the burden of make frequent mistakes was much easier to carry.

What we need is just to create the link between kids that have what the other one has (the knowledge of their mother tongue) and give them the empowerment to realize they can be the one that will teach the other.
It will really become an active learning process, and teachers will guide the social process of learning by being close to the kids as they learn and teach.
I want that with this program every kid with access to a computer room in their school can have at least one our a week of real, engaging and high quality learning in one of the foundations of any language: pronunciation, spelling and word identification.
At the same time, I want that students stop feeling that learning depends in the teacher and realize that it depends in their own work, to embrace their own learning process.
Finally, I want that they develop the skills necessary to improve in learning by becoming teachers and value what they can give: their own knowledge in their mother tongue, this will empower the kids since they will notice they have something to offer that is very valuable for the other.
1. Have a structure of how to make the meetings between kids. To guarantee privacy and safety.
2. Find a technique that makes the correction between kids fun and positive.
3. Have a list of words kids will learn to start.
4. Have a list of sentences kids will learn to start.
5. Have a prototype software.
6. Make trials between two small groups.
7. Have a way to make peer assessment between kids to check pronunciation, spelling, identification of words and grammar.
Outputs: learning a second language with a cultural meaning or from a person with a cultural relation.
Short term outcomes: learn how to interact, model and correct another person.
Medium term outcomes: development of a second language and increase value of their common culture.
Long term outcomes: Love to their common culture, creation of friendships with people far away.
Ii think my idea as an app kids will use in class in a computer, in order to guarantee an adult is supervising the interactions and can be attentive to difficulties.
I needs to use internet to make kids be in real contact and a very simple system to congratulate or correct the other in a positive and constructive way.
